Satisfying the Prerequisites for Electrician School

There are some requirements to become eligible for electrician training programs.

  • Be at least 18 years of age
  • Have a GED or high school diploma
  • Have evidence that you’ve finished at least one semester of algebra

Popular Electrician’s Certifications

You’ll find 11 types of licenses an electrician can earn. Operating within a particular field requires one to hold the right one.

  • Electrical Contractor License
  • Residential Electrical Contractor
  • Class A Master Electrician
  • Class B Master Electrician
  • Residential Master Electrician
  • Class A Journeyman Electrician
  • Class B Journeyman Electrician
  • Residential Electrician
  • Apprentice Electrician
  • Special Electrician
  • Unclassified Person
